Output 115e15b20c7dfd0be836973f2f3f12ae4aaad5bae7815c00516cf1a577ec6220:0

value
3079196
script pubkey
OP_HASH160 OP_PUSHBYTES_20 17b192c54b1d0632ef159f11256c29ed33f9db0f OP_EQUAL
address
33rJBy21Fgh6ede1YE2FXDRNW8MpSZRh4u
transaction
115e15b20c7dfd0be836973f2f3f12ae4aaad5bae7815c00516cf1a577ec6220
spent
true